Remote access unit and radio-over-fiber network using same. Jae-Hoon Lee, Seong-taek Hwang, Byung-Jik Kim, Gyu-Woong Lee, Hoon Kim, Sang-Ho Kim, Yong-Gyoo Kim, Sung-Kee Kim, & Han-Lim Lee February 2010.
Paper abstract bibtex A remote access unit (RAU) apparatus, coupled to a central station (CS) of an RoF network through at least one optical fiber, and which RAU apparatus includes at least one antenna, includes: first and second antenna ports coupled to the at least one antenna; first and second optical fiber ports coupled to the at least one optical fiber; a first coupler for decoupling a first downstream signal of a first duplexing method and a second downstream signal of a second duplexing method, which are input through the first optical fiber port; a circulator for outputting the first downstream signal input from the first coupler to the first antenna port and outputting a first upstream signal of the first duplexing method input from the first antenna port to the second optical fiber port; and a second coupler for outputting the second downstream signal input from the first coupler to the second antenna port and outputting a second upstream signal of the second duplexing method input from the second antenna port to the second optical fiber port.
